An Overview of the State League 1 Reserves

The State League 1 Reserves in South Australia serves as a crucial stepping stone for emerging talent. Clubs participating in the reserves are often the proving ground for players who aspire to reach their respective first teams and beyond. The matches scheduled for tomorrow promise not only points and bragging rights but also significant implications for player development and team momentum.

Betting Markets to Watch in State League 1 Reserves Matches

Bettors searching for an edge in South Australia’s State League 1 Reserves matches often target specialized markets that reflect the league's patterns and team strengths. Tomorrow’s fixtures offer several intriguing options beyond the standard 1X2 bets.

  • Goals Markets: With many matches historically featuring end-to-end action, Over/Under 2.5 and 3.5 goals markets are perennially popular.
  • Both Teams to Score (BTTS): Given the attacking intent displayed by reserve teams, BTTS is frequently a profitable play.
  • First Goalscorer: For those seeking higher odds, predicting the player to open the scoring can offer significant returns—especially when key forwards are in form.
  • Asian Handicap: When there are clear mismatches or strong home favorites, the Asian Handicap lines allow for reduced risk or enhanced odds.
